MongoDB
 sql >> Baza danych >  >> NoSQL >> MongoDB

Wydajność przy wkładaniu do mongodb (pymongo)

Sugerowałbym używanie mongostatu podczas przeprowadzania testów. Jest wiele rzeczy, które mogą się mylić, ale mongostat da ci dobrą wskazówkę.

http://docs.mongodb.org/manual/reference/mongostat/

Pierwsze dwie rzeczy, na które chciałbym spojrzeć, to procent blokady i przepustowość danych. Przy rozsądnej przepustowości na dedykowanych maszynach zazwyczaj dostaję się do 1000-2000 aktualizacji/wstawek na sekundę, zanim doznam jakiejkolwiek degradacji. Tak było w przypadku kilku dużych wdrożeń produkcyjnych, z którymi pracowałem.




  1. Redis
  2.   
  3. MongoDB
  4.   
  5. Memcached
  6.   
  7. HBase
  8.   
  9. CouchDB
  1. Sterownik php MongoDB powodujący awarię Apache w XAMPP OS X

  2. Uzyskaj wartość w referencji wyszukiwania za pomocą MongoDB i Golang

  3. Sprawdź, czy dokument istnieje w mongodb za pomocą es7 async/await

  4. MongoDB $in Operator potoku agregacji

  5. Jak wykonać zapytanie za pomocą lub warunek w mongoid